Compact and miniature diffuse sensors featuring background suppression offer reliable functionality even when detecting very dark or shiny objects. These sensors are manipulation-proof and can be easily calibrated using a straightforward teach-in method via qTeach. Leveraging the time-of-flight principle ensures extended sensing distances, while laser performance enhances accuracy in switching behavior. The sensors come in a compact, miniaturized housing format.
General Specifications:
- Type: Background Suppression
- Version: Time of Flight
- Light Source: Pulsed Red Laser Diode
- Sensing Distance (Tw): 100 to 1800 mm
- Sensing Range (Tb): 70 to 1890 mm
- Repeat Accuracy: ≤ 1400 to 5500 µm
- Temperature Drift: ±15 mm
- Power On Indication: LED Green
- Output Indicator: LED Yellow
- Sensing Distance Adjustment: qTeach
- Laser Class: 1
- Distance to Focus: 700 mm
- Wavelength: 680 nm
- Suppression of Reciprocal Influence: Yes
- Beam Type: Point
- Alignment Optical Axis: < 2°
Electrical Data:
- Response Time/Release Time: < 8 ms
- Voltage Supply Range (+Vs): 12 to 30 VDC
- Current Consumption (Max, No Load): 60 mA
- Voltage Drop (Vd): < 2 VDC
- Output Function: Light Operate, Complementary
- Output Circuit: PNP
- Output Current: < 50 mA (Sum of All Outputs)
- Short Circuit Protection: Yes
- Reverse Polarity Protection: Yes
Mechanical Data:
- Width/Diameter: 12.9 mm
- Height/Length: 32.3 mm
- Depth: 23 mm
- Type: Rectangular
- Housing Material: Plastic (ASA, PMMA)
- Front (Optics): PMMA
- Connection Types: Connector M8 4 Pin
Ambient Conditions:
- Protection Class: IP 67
- Operating Temperature: -20 to +50 °C
- Storage Temperature: -40 to +70 °C
- Vibration (Sinusoidal): IEC 60068-2-6:2008, 10 g at f = 10 – 2000 Hz, duration 150 min per axis
- Shock (Semi-Sinusoidal): IEC 60068-2-27:2009, 50 g / 11 ms, 10 impulses per axis and direction
